Can I revert the indicator led on Moes smart touch switches?

Hi all.
I have moes smart touch switches and they work well with zemismart driver.
But led indicator on the panel turn on ( blue led ) when light is on.
I need just the opposite, when lights are off it needs to be on.
It is possible change it with moes hub ( which i don't have ).
Inside the code there is possibility to change it but it does not shown in the device settings.

Hi @Reuven ,

You can try the dev. branch version 0.2.14 timestamp "2022/11/22 7:58 AM" - added 'ledMOode' command.

Hello! Is it possible to configure the led mode individually Component Devices (childs)?

Yes without any problems.
Please see the last message from @kkossev .

Actually, the configuration of the LED mode is in effect for all the gangs / for each child. It is a single configuration command that affects all channels.

But now ive had this awesome idea of been able to use a motion sensor to change the led in the switch to come on when it sensors motion near it do you know if thats possible?

Yes, it is possible to change the LED status 'on the fly'. This can be done from HE Rule Machine - try to send a Custom command 'Led Mode' with a parameter "Lit when On" or "Lit when Off".
